SEO is elusive. We chase Page 1 ranking, hoping that we know what the search engines want to see. Yet, Google and other search engines are telling us: If you create quality content, virality will happen. I call it Human Eye Optimization - creating content for people. This deck covers the 5 Elements of HEO

...the overriding kind of goal is ... high-quality content, the sort of content that people really enjoy, that's compelling, the sort of thing that they'll love to read that you might see in a magazine or in a book, and that people would refer back to, or send friends to, those sorts of things…

Sept. 11, 2013, Matt Cutts via YouTube’s Google Webmasters Channel

1. SEARCHABLE & CLICKABLE TITLES

• N: Take a Walk on the Wild Side

• S: What is Urban Foraging?

• S&C: Urban Foraging - Finding Wild Food in Your Own Back Yard

@noelleschuck

Keyword phrases

Action verbs

Numbers

Clarity

Echo long-tail searches

@noelleschuck

2. STRONG LEAD PARAGRAPHS

• Perspective - Why should I care? What does this mean to my world?

• Poignancy - How does this make me feel?

• Preview - What’s this about?

@noelleschuck

3. SUBSTANCE

• Empty advice “You should get that fixed.”

• Telling without showing “This is important because it’s important.”

• Stating the obvious. “If it’s in stock, we have it!”

• Wordiness. “Certified Pre-Owned” “Used”

@noelleschuck

4. RELEVANCE

Less me, we, and I and more you

@noelleschuck

5. VISUAL APPEAL

• To gain several minutes of user attention, you must clearly communicate your value proposition within 10 seconds. (nngroup.com)

• Users will be able to read about 20% of text on the average page. (nngroup.com)
